Thrust is not a whole lot on those things. thinking it over actually 45oz may be a bit sluggish with those fans. I have a few of those and you can basically treat them like hot 380's with 5x2 props. There pretty much at there max with 8 hecells's so 10 cp1300's to both of them will work allright. You might, depending on how big you've allready made it, be better using Minifans in it. Don't forget, this is not only a draggy delta wing, but a draggy delta wing with tons of extra surfaces. Even with 29oz and Minifan with 8 zapped CP1700's mine wasn't exactly a smoker. If I had it again I would think about doing a plate wing on it, and a Single Midi Fan. And I too redid the nose 6 times before I just gave up trying to do it in balsa and hotwired it. Still wasn't happy with it. And I really didn't have a problem with the intakes down low. I did the Fuse sides and the divider running back right to the cone out of 32nd so it was pretty beefy. And I had a battery tray hidden just behind that sweep up underneath the intakes too. You'll find batts have to go under the plane cause in the nose it's gonna swap ends when you chuck it like the X-31.
